Blog Archives

MLB: Giants Take Series From Braves

The San Francisco Giants went 7-3 on a 10-game road trip before heading home for a seven-game home stand against the Atlanta Braves and the Miami Marlins. The Giants started off the home stand by going 2-1 against the Braves … Continue reading